NEW DIRECTORS FOR BIG BROTHERS BIG SISTERS

The Tribune
Published: Friday, July 28, 2006
Page: C1

Big Brothers Big Sisters of San Luis Obispo County installed three new directors at its recent board meeting. Joining the board for three-year terms are Lisa Hoyt of Environmental Analytical Service Inc., Damien Porter of Central Coast Business Passport and Heather Senecal of San Luis Coastal Unified School District.

Other board members for 2006 are President Hal Sweasey, Vice President Clint Pearce, Secretary Bryan Gingg, Treasurer Marian Anderson, Jayne Brown, John Koepf, Monique Carlton, Carol Florence, Jed Nicholson, Julie Tizzano-Schumann and Christie Tjong.

Big Brothers Big Sisters of San Luis Obispo County has been serving the Central Coast for 11 years, during which it has matched more than 800 children with adult mentors. For information about Big Brothers Big Sisters, call 781-3226, or visit www.slobigs.org.
